Handover — ParityScope

On-call notes for the rate-parity checker. ParityScope scrapes partner rates for the Hollowvale hotel group every 20 minutes and flags deltas over 3%. Known issues: the Brimstead feed times out at peak; retries are capped at 4, don't raise them. Alert noise spikes Sunday nights — that's the partner cache refresh, ignore unless sustained past an hour. Escalate genuine parity breaches to the pricing desk channel. The checker currently runs with these configuration values.

deployment values, yadug-bawif:
[framir]
team = pelox
access_code = ac_a38ab2
owner = tamion.julael
host = framir.tolvaqlabs.test
port = 11211
peer = tammir.zemvargrid.local
salt = 2215ef03
pin = 1541

Q2 Planning Note — Heads of Department

The overhaul of the Amberline loyalty programme begins in earnest this quarter. Points accrual will shift from transaction count to spend value, and the Silver tier will be retired after a nine-month grace period. Department leads should map customer-facing dependencies by week four and flag system constraints to the Harlow Street team. The commercial reasoning is noted below.

confidential, yawif-fadup: The southern region missed its Eliius quota by 61.1 percent last quarter. Istixax Freight plans to raise the Jorwyn list price by 65.7 percent in October. The board signed off on a budget of $445.3 million for Project Ulaox. The renewal with Briathax Partners closes at $41.0 million a year, 49.9 percent below the last contract.

## Releases

The Plowline gateway ships telemetry firmware to combines and balers in the field, so release discipline matters. Tag the release from the frozen branch only after the soak tests on the Harrowfield bench rig pass twice consecutively. Build artifacts are produced by the hermetic pipeline and must never be hand-edited. Before publishing to the fleet update channel, verify every artifact's signature against the release signing key shown below.

signing key of kahog-kadup = bky13_6wLyxnPsJob4P

**Vendor note: Inkmill markdown pipeline**

Rendering for Parchway docs is outsourced to Inkmill under an annual contract, renewing each March. They handle sanitization and PDF export; we own the upload queue. SLA: 4-hour response on rendering failures. Escalate only after two failed retries. Their support desk is reachable at the address below.

billing contact of hahaf-baguf = zorael.tammir.jorius@sivrelhq.internal